The social harm of dangerous driving behavior is an objective existence, but whether only establishing a new charge in the criminal law can control them effectively is a question. Although the "Criminal Law Amendment (8)" have been adopted and implemented , though the theory and judicial practice hold a positive attitude to the necessary establishment of the offense, and there is also opposition around. Study of the problem, for solving the corresponding wage acts like a malicious crime into question the reasonableness of the inspiration of great significance, but also better able to guide the judicial practice.Dangerous driving charge means driving the motor vehicle on the road chasing seriously or the behavior of driving on the road drunk. The problem of applicable scope is pointed out through elaborating the basic concept of dangerous driving crime and characteristics and the reason of formulating criminal charges. Then elaborate the grounds of fighting against formulating criminal charges from micro and macro level.Formulating dangerous driving crime in criminal law cannot solve the specific issues on micro level and obey the basic theory on macro level whether it is the problem of fact, implementation or other issues caused by charge from micro level or the principal of humility, the foundation of illegality or risk social theory. However, it is undoubted on hazards of dangerous driving. It should tackle how to prevent that kind of dangerous behavior from happening in the existing legal system. Coordinating the relationship among administrative penalty, criminal penalty and inner of criminal penalty is very helpful for judicial practice to apply law correctly.
